J1: Incentivizing Thinking in LLM-as-a-Judge via Reinforcement Learning

Whitehouse, Chenxi, Wang, Tianlu, Yu, Ping et al.

Understand

The progress of AI is bottlenecked by the quality of evaluation, making powerful LLM-as-a-Judge models a core solution.

  • The efficacy of these judges depends on their chain-of-thought reasoning, creating a critical need for methods that can effectively optimize this reasoning process.
  • In this work, we introduce J1, a reinforcement learning framework for teaching LLM judges to think before making decisions.
  • Our core contribution lies in converting all judgment tasks for non-verifiable and verifiable prompts into a unified format with verifiable rewards, enabling direct optimization of evaluation quality while mitigating positional bias.
